Small Act of Green Rebellion: Wear clothes that help to close the loop.

From the most supported clothing launch on Kickstarter to using coffee grounds in their hoodies and socks, Coalatree has created a brand that thinks as much about durability as they do about sustainability. JM Fabrizi, Director of Brand Development, joins us to chat about how the brand has successfully launched several products on Kickstarter, from the Kachula Blanket to the Trailhead Pants. Their evolution hoodies is made out of a  fabric, developed in Taiwan and Bluesign certified, that has helped to remove over 140,000 plastic bottles and 82,000 cups of coffee grounds from the waste stream so far.
